summaryrefslogtreecommitdiffstats
path: root/src/base/main
diff options
context:
space:
mode:
authorAlan Mishchenko <alanmi@berkeley.edu>2011-08-02 12:01:49 +0700
committerAlan Mishchenko <alanmi@berkeley.edu>2011-08-02 12:01:49 +0700
commit64f31f98bf5b317dc08f0e96bf1aa617053c918d (patch)
tree49d0259a572dd2a76dbb2a72c11a14d652367bc6 /src/base/main
parent6c6c0b06868110f1d635bb4da40647494fbe6905 (diff)
downloadabc-64f31f98bf5b317dc08f0e96bf1aa617053c918d.tar.gz
abc-64f31f98bf5b317dc08f0e96bf1aa617053c918d.tar.bz2
abc-64f31f98bf5b317dc08f0e96bf1aa617053c918d.zip
Added API to access the CEX vector.
Diffstat (limited to 'src/base/main')
-rw-r--r--src/base/main/main.h1
-rw-r--r--src/base/main/mainFrame.c1
2 files changed, 2 insertions, 0 deletions
diff --git a/src/base/main/main.h b/src/base/main/main.h
index f8d6c1ab..134af6e2 100644
--- a/src/base/main/main.h
+++ b/src/base/main/main.h
@@ -109,6 +109,7 @@ extern ABC_DLL int Abc_FrameIsFlagEnabled( char * pFlag );
extern ABC_DLL int Abc_FrameReadBmcFrames( Abc_Frame_t * p );
extern ABC_DLL int Abc_FrameReadProbStatus( Abc_Frame_t * p );
extern ABC_DLL Abc_Cex_t * Abc_FrameReadCex( Abc_Frame_t * p );
+extern ABC_DLL Vec_Ptr_t * Abc_FrameReadCexVec( Abc_Frame_t * p );
extern ABC_DLL int Abc_FrameReadCexPiNum( Abc_Frame_t * p );
extern ABC_DLL int Abc_FrameReadCexRegNum( Abc_Frame_t * p );
diff --git a/src/base/main/mainFrame.c b/src/base/main/mainFrame.c
index cd743977..658bc34e 100644
--- a/src/base/main/mainFrame.c
+++ b/src/base/main/mainFrame.c
@@ -61,6 +61,7 @@ char * Abc_FrameReadFlag( char * pFlag ) { return Cmd_FlagRe
int Abc_FrameReadBmcFrames( Abc_Frame_t * p ) { return s_GlobalFrame->nFrames; }
int Abc_FrameReadProbStatus( Abc_Frame_t * p ) { return s_GlobalFrame->Status; }
Abc_Cex_t * Abc_FrameReadCex( Abc_Frame_t * p ) { return s_GlobalFrame->pCex; }
+Vec_Ptr_t * Abc_FrameReadCexVec( Abc_Frame_t * p ) { return s_GlobalFrame->vCexVec; }
int Abc_FrameReadCexPiNum( Abc_Frame_t * p ) { return s_GlobalFrame->pCex->nPis; }
int Abc_FrameReadCexRegNum( Abc_Frame_t * p ) { return s_GlobalFrame->pCex->nRegs; }